About Castello Scaligero Di Villafranca
Castello Scaligero Di Villafranca is a storied medieval castle in Villafranca di Verona, Italy, serving as a versatile open-air event venue with courtyards and adaptable setups. Since hosting notable performances from acts like Bob Dylan (1998) and Coldplay (2000) to contemporary cultural fairs, this historic site continues to welcome a variety of events. With a flexible seating approach—no permanent seating chart and configurations that can include temporary stands or terraces—the castle provides a unique backdrop for concerts, performances, and festivals in the Veneto region.

Know that capacity can vary by event, with historical references citing approximately 4,750 seats in 2016 and figures reaching higher totals (up to ~7,000 or more) depending on the setup. For day-of logistics, expect organized attrezzati (prepared) parking areas near the castle for big events. Transit access is convenient: Villafranca di Verona railway station on the Verona–Mantova–Modena line, road access via the A4 (Sommacampagna) and A22, plus regional bus links to the Garda area. Seating, Parking & Venue Information
- Location/address: Castello Scaligero, Corso Vittorio Emanuele II, Piazza Castello, 37069 Villafranca di Verona VR, Italy.
- Venue type: historic medieval castle used as an open-air event venue with courtyards and adaptable setups.
- Seating/chart: no fixed, permanent seating chart published; configurations are event-dependent with temporary stands or terraces as needed.
- Capacity: attested 4,750 seats (2016 capienza); some sources list up to ~7,000 or even 10,000 depending on setup.
- Parking: organized parking areas for events (attrezzati) near the castle; dedicated parking arrangements described for major festivals.
- Transit: nearby train access via Villafranca di Verona station on the Verona–Mantova–Modena line; road access via A4 (Sommacampagna) and A22; regional bus links to Garda area.

- Notable events hosted: Bob Dylan performed there in 1998 and Coldplay in 2000 (Rockaforte festival); ongoing events include Villafranca Fest and other cultural/fair happenings.
